HARRISON, Mrs. Lynette-age 64 passed away Wednesday, June 26, 2013 at her residence. The family of Mrs. Harrison will be present to receive friends and visitors from 2:00 p.m.- 4:00 p.m. Tuesday, July 2, 2013 at Serenity Funeral Chapel G-2340 W. Carpenter Rd. Flint, MI 48505. There will be no public viewing.

Lynette (Beck) Harrison was born July 21, 1948 in Flint, MI the daughter of Coy and Olivia Beck. Lynette was raised in Flint, MI and graduated from Flint Northern High School c/o 1967. Lynette worked at General Motors Metal Fab for 9 years and from there she became a homemaker. Mrs. Harrison loved to dance and listen to music but she loved her grandchildren most of all. They were the center of her life. If you knew Lynette Harrison you felt the love and wisdom that she was so happy to share.

Mrs. Harrison leaves to cherish her memory: husband; Gregory Harrison of Flint, MI., children; Sonya Harrison, Sammara Harrison, Mikki (Marlando) Wade, Tamasha (Dorrin) Harrold, grandchildren; Adrian Sean Harrison, Kayla Tamasha Harrold, Jamik Gregory White, Lyric Sanae White, Dorrin Christopher Harrold, Samar Rochaun Keys Harrison all of Flint, MI., sister; Reena (Mark) Haralson, dear cousin; Darryl Smith, nieces; Tameka Makenze, Missy Haralson, Marketa Hightower.

Mrs. Lynette Harrison was preceded in death by her mother Olivia Beck.
